Output 06245666de4f79302b310b3ab9227a4f3d52e13894dc73e65a95554a025d525a:1

value
889515
script pubkey
OP_0 OP_PUSHBYTES_20 ddf6802c07a40e2c895e177f2679d9f26bf06930
address
bc1qmhmgqtq85s8zez27zaljv7we7f4lq6fslepug7
transaction
06245666de4f79302b310b3ab9227a4f3d52e13894dc73e65a95554a025d525a
spent
true